Haibo Xing is a scholar working on Molecular Biology, Food Science and Oncology. According to data from OpenAlex, Haibo Xing has authored 43 papers receiving a total of 946 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 7 papers in Food Science and 6 papers in Oncology. Recurrent topics in Haibo Xing's work include Advanced biosensing and bioanalysis techniques (13 papers), Melamine detection and toxicity (6 papers) and Gold and Silver Nanoparticles Synthesis and Applications (5 papers). Haibo Xing is often cited by papers focused on Advanced biosensing and bioanalysis techniques (13 papers), Melamine detection and toxicity (6 papers) and Gold and Silver Nanoparticles Synthesis and Applications (5 papers). Haibo Xing collaborates with scholars based in China, Australia and Indonesia. Haibo Xing's co-authors include Pei Zhou, Yuangen Wu, Shenshan Zhan, Lan He, Fu-Xiang Tian, Bin Xu, Lurong Xu, Yu-qiong Gao, Da Li and Mengting Tong and has published in prestigious journals such as PLoS ONE, Biomaterials and Advanced Functional Materials.
